Root Touch Up: Keep Your Hair Color Fresh and Natural
A root touch up is one of the most common services people book between full-color appointments. It helps keep your hair color even and polished.
What Is a Root Touch Up?
A root touch up targets the new hair growth near your scalp to match your existing hair color. It prevents visible regrowth lines and helps maintain your style longer.
When Should You Get It Done?
Every 4–6 weeks is ideal, depending on how fast your hair grows and the contrast between your roots and colored hair.
Types of Root Touch Up Services
- Basic Root Touch Up Hair Color: For people who dye their full hair and want to cover regrowth.
- Quick Roots Touch Up: A short session for travelers or those attending events soon.
- Top Rated Root Touch Up for Highlights: Blends regrowth with highlighted strands for a seamless look.
Why Choose a Professional Salon?
DIY kits might seem cheaper, but they can lead to uneven coloring or hair damage. Professional salons in Surrey BC and downtown Vancouver use ammonia-free and long-lasting color formulas, ensuring your hair remains shiny and healthy.

Hair Highlights: Add a Stylish Touch on a Budget
If you’re looking to brighten your hair without a full color change, hair highlights are a great choice. They add depth and movement, making your hair appear fuller and more vibrant.
Types of Highlights You Can Try
- Partial Highlights: Add color to the front or crown for a natural, sun-kissed look.
- Full Highlights: Spread evenly through your hair for more contrast.
- Balayage: Hand-painted highlights that grow out naturally, reducing maintenance.
Salons in Vancouver often offer affordable highlight packages, using modern coloring techniques that are safe and gentle.
Money-Saving Tips for First-Time Salon Visitors
If you’re visiting Vancouver or booking your first salon appointment, here are ways to save money while getting a professional haircut:
- Book on Weekdays: Salons are less crowded and often have lower rates midweek.
- Ask for a Junior Stylist: Trained under senior professionals, they offer excellent cuts at reduced prices.
- Bring a Reference Photo: Helps your stylist understand exactly what you want, avoiding costly mistakes.
- Join Loyalty Programs: Many salons reward regular clients with discounts or free add-ons.
- Combine Services: If you need both a trim and a roots touch up, ask about combo packages.

How to Maintain Your Hair After the Salon
Keeping your hair healthy after your appointment ensures your root touch up or haircut lasts longer:
- Use color-safe or sulfate-free shampoo.
- Limit heat styling and apply a heat protectant when necessary.
- Schedule regular trims every 6–8 weeks.
- Protect colored hair from sun exposure and chlorine.
- Deep condition once a week to maintain shine.
These small habits will help your hair stay strong and vibrant until your next visit.

Q1: How much does a haircut cost in Vancouver?
Most basic haircuts range between $25–$60, depending on the salon and stylist experience. Specialty cuts or color services may cost more.
Q2: How often should I get a root touch up?
Typically, every 4–6 weeks keeps your hair color even and fresh, especially for darker roots or lighter shades.
